Hair care sales fell in 2020, mainly as a result of salon closures. Salon hair care lost two full months of sales during the lockdown, and even when sales picked up in the summer as salons re-opened, they were not able to recoup the lost sales of spring. In addition, the second wave of COVID-19 in the autumn impacted sales towards the end of the year, when hair salons are usually busy ahead of the Christmas season.
